Natalya Butuzova is a human[1]. Born in Uzbek Soviet Socialist Republic[2], she… she was born on February 17, 1954[3]. She worked as an archer[4]. She has Wikipedia articles in 14 language editions, a strong signal of global cultural recognition.[5]
